The 10-90 percent utilisation on the gold CC account, how exactly is that calculated? Is is as a average utilisation over the month, calculated on a specific date or you need to stay in the parameters regardless?
lets say for arguments sake i have a 10K limit on my card and need to swipe for 11k, I transfer 11k into the account taking me into a positive balance then swipe, i have fallen out of the 10-90% band going temporarily to a 0% utilisation, do i lose the points for the month. Conversely, if I swipe and use 9.5k of my available account balance that takes me to 95% utilisation.

The rule says "Use between 10% and 90% of your credit limit during a calendar month
Your maximum budget and/or straight balance is/are taken into consideration when calculating your credit limit usage on your FNB Gold Credit Card."
Using you example my interpretation is; make sure that at some point during the month you were at -R1000 for your credit card balance. Ensure that you swiped for at least R1000. Ensure you didn't allow your balance to become less than -R9000.
Transferring 11k into the ccard account to give you a positive balance for a bit is ok. Reaching -R9500 is not ok.
Disclaimer: I'm not privy to the inner workings of how their rules might actually work.
